Q: Is 25,724,128 a Prime Number?
A: No, 25,724,128 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 25724128 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 17 32 34 68 136 272 544 47,287 94,574 189,148 378,296 756,592 803,879 1,513,184 1,607,758 3,215,516 6,431,032 12,862,064 and 25,724,128, with no remainder.
Since 25,724,128 cannot be divided by just 1 and 25,724,128, it is not a prime number.
